服务器设置VMware的基础准备
在开始服务器设置VMware之前,充分的准备工作是确保部署顺利的关键,需确认服务器的硬件配置是否符合VMware的要求,包括CPU支持虚拟化技术(如Intel VT-x或AMD-V)、足够的内存容量(建议至少16GB,具体根据虚拟机数量和负载调整)、充足的存储空间(推荐使用SSD以提高性能)以及网络接口卡(至少千兆以太网),下载与服务器硬件兼容的VMware版本,如VMware ESXi(企业级轻量级hypervisor)或VMware vSphere(功能完整的数据中心虚拟化套件),并准备一个至少8GB的U盘用于制作启动安装盘,建议提前规划好网络拓扑,包括虚拟交换机的配置、IP地址分配以及存储访问权限,避免安装后出现网络或存储连接问题。

VMware ESXi的安装与基础配置
VMware ESXi作为直接安装在服务器硬件上的轻量级虚拟化平台,安装过程相对简单,将制作好的ESXi安装盘插入服务器,从U盘启动并进入安装界面,根据提示选择语言、键盘布局后,同意许可协议并选择安装目标磁盘(建议单独使用一块磁盘作为ESXi系统盘,避免与虚拟机存储冲突),安装完成后,通过ESXi自带的Direct Console Interface (DCI) 或连接显示器输入初始IP地址(默认为DHCP分配,也可手动配置静态IP),登录Web管理客户端(地址为https://服务器IP/ui),首次登录需修改root密码,并在“网络设置”中配置管理网络,包括IP、子网掩码、网关和DNS,确保服务器能正常访问外网。
虚拟机的创建与资源配置
在VMware vSphere Client中连接到ESXi主机后,即可创建虚拟机,点击“创建/注册虚拟机”,选择“创建新的虚拟机”,向导式操作需注意以下几点:
- 名称与客户操作系统:为虚拟机命名(如“Web-Server”),并选择对应的操作系统类型(如Linux、Windows Server)和版本,VMware会自动匹配兼容的硬件配置。
- 存储选择:根据虚拟机用途分配存储,建议将虚拟机文件(.vmdk)存放于高性能存储(如SSD数据存储),同时启用“厚置备延迟置零”或“精简配置”(后者节省空间但需注意性能)。
- 硬件配置:根据负载需求分配CPU核心数(建议至少2vCPU)、内存(至少4GB)、网络(选择虚拟交换机,如VMK0用于管理,vSwitch0用于虚拟机通信)以及磁盘容量(可动态扩展),创建完成后,通过ISO文件挂载操作系统安装镜像,启动虚拟机完成系统安装。
网络与存储的高级配置
虚拟化环境中,网络与存储的灵活配置直接影响性能与管理效率,在网络方面,ESXi支持标准交换机(vSwitch)和分布式交换机(vDS),标准交换机可直接在单个主机上配置端口组(Port Group),划分VLAN隔离流量;分布式交换机则可跨多主机统一管理,适合集群环境,需注意,虚拟机网络需与物理网络规划保持一致,例如配置端口组VLAN ID以实现二层隔离。

存储配置方面,ESXi支持多种存储类型,包括本地存储(服务器直连硬盘)、NAS( NFS/iSCSI)和SAN(FC-SAN),通过“存储器”添加数据存储时,需确保主机有访问权限(例如iSCSI需配置目标器、CHAP认证),对于关键业务,可配置存储策略(如存储DRS、数据持久化),确保虚拟机磁盘的高可用性和性能。
安全管理与性能优化
服务器设置VMware后,安全管理需贯穿始终,限制vSphere Client的访问权限,通过“角色-权限”功能为不同用户分配最小权限(如只读、管理员等),避免使用root账户频繁操作,启用ESXi防火墙,仅开放必要端口(如HTTPS、SSH),并定期更新VMware补丁以修复安全漏洞。
性能优化方面,可从硬件和软件双维度入手:硬件上,确保NUMA架构对齐(避免虚拟机CPU跨NUMA节点访问内存),使用SR-IOV技术直通网卡或GPU给虚拟机以减少IO开销;软件上,合理设置虚拟机资源份额(Shares)、限制(Limit)和预留(Reservation),避免资源争抢,同时启用内存 ballooning和内存压缩(ESXi 6.0+)以提升内存利用率。

通过以上步骤,可完成VMware在服务器上的基础部署与配置,构建稳定、高效的虚拟化平台,后续可根据业务需求,进一步扩展集群功能(如vMotion、HA、FT),或集成vCenter实现统一管理,为企业数字化转型提供灵活的IT基础设施支撑。
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/126198.html




